[Code of Federal Regulations] [Title 40, Volume 20] [Revised as of July 1, 2002] From the U.S. Government Printing Office via GPO Access [CITE: 40CFR177.99] [Page 280] TITLE 40--PROTECTION OF ENVIRONMENT CHAPTER I--ENVIRONMENTAL PROTECTION AGENCY (CONTINUED) PART 177--ISSUANCE OF FOOD ADDITIVE REGULATIONS--Table of Contents Subpart E--Procedures for Filing Petitions Sec. 177.99 Demand for action. A petitioner may demand action on a petition if the Administrator has not acted on the petition within the timeframes in FFDCA section 409(c)(2). Upon receipt of such a demand, the Administrator shall take appropriate action under FFDCA section 409(c)(1).
